The way I look at it, we all marry the wrong people. Not much you can do about it really. I remember when I went to ask Edward if he’d mind if I took one of his daughters off his hands, he said –“well you’ve a choice of three evils.” Too late to do a swap, isn’t it?
Three couples come together for a wedding anniversary; each couple seems generally unsuited. During the course of the evening’s events and at the end of each act, the partners change while retaining their original characters. The final scene sees all variants of the relationships mixed together and on stage. Throughout this, there runs a sub-plot of the couples trying to discover whether their father is out to kill their mother.
